One of the standout features of this 3.5mm bit is its 135° split point geometry. Unlike standard drill bits that require a center punch to start, the SST+ split point is self-centering. It bites into the material immediately upon contact, eliminating the tendency to "walk" or wander across the surface. This precision is vital when drilling on curved surfaces or when exact hole placement is required. Furthermore, the bit features a unique "High Flow" flute design. This geometry is optimized to evacuate chips rapidly from the hole, preventing chip packing and heat buildup—two common causes of premature bit failure in stainless steel applications.
Durability is further enhanced by Walter's proprietary bronze SST surface treatment. This treatment acts as a lubricant and a protective layer, reducing friction between the bit and the workpiece. Combined with a back-tapered body design that minimizes contact with the hole walls, the 01D535 reduces torque requirements and prevents binding.
